A micrometer is an instrument used for making precise linear measurements of dimensions such as diameter, thickness, and lengths of solid bodies. It is made of a C-shaped frame with a movable jaw operated by an integral screw. The fineness of the measurement depends on the lead of the screw while the accuracy of the measurement depends on the accuracy of the screw-nut combination. It is often misunderstood with the micrometer (μm) – the standard unit of length measurement. Another common name used for a micrometer is micrometer caliper due to its similar appearance to the caliper. Parts of a Micrometer A micrometer is composed of the following parts: • Frame– It is the C-shaped body that holds the anvil and barrel in constant relation to each other. The frame is heavy and has high thermal mass. Carbide tips provide additional wear resistance for a micrometer, especially one that may see extra heavy usage. While they can be useful in this regard, the carbide tips are more brittle and have been known to chip. For most people, your standard stainless-steel spindle and anvil will be good enough but both types work well. These micrometers have a special anvil and spindle to allow them to measure the opposite sides of a thread. The anvil has a double v shape while the spindle is pointed. They have an overall measuring range such as 0-1” or 1-2” like a standard micrometer but also have a range of threads per inch or mm that they are capable of measuring. Heat can cause metal or other materials to expand. When this happens, your part can appear to measure larger than it actually is. The same principle affects your measuring tool as well. This is why many micrometers will have an insulated grip to keep you from transferring your body heat to the micrometer and affecting the measurements.
